Who You Are & The Impact You Will Have:

The Federal Project Manager executes critical projects within QTS Federal. These projects will primarily be in two categories: delivery and process development. In delivery projects, the Federal Project Manager will guide customers, partners, and QTS Federal stakeholders through a complex design and construction process while serving as the primary point of contact for customer project leadership. This is a critical function that involves orchestrating a variety of stakeholders and coordinating all aspects of a successful data center project delivery. In process development projects, the Federal Project Manager will support QTS Federal Leadership in refining delivery models for QTS Federal products and services. The Federal Project Manager reports to the Director of Federal Project Delivery.


What You Will Do:

* Manage and maintain excellent customer relationships. Clearly documenting goals, managing expectations, and managing project outcomes to ensure customer satisfaction and success.

* Coordinate data center deployment projects from kickoff to completion. Create and maintain project plans: outlining tasks, milestone dates and allocation of resources.

* Understand the operating models of key QTS and QTS Federal stakeholder organizations to promote effective communication. These groups include, but are not limited to: Sales, Facility Operations, Property Development, Implementation, Technology Operations, and Security.

* Provide timely and accurate status updates to all customer, partner and QTS Federal st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le.

* Own and manage customer project escalations through to resolution, and ensure expectations are clearly set with customer and QTS teams.

* Assist in the development and maintenance of project methodology to improve QTS Federal services and offerings.

* Support QTS Federal Leadership in process improvement and process development projects as the company experiences rapid growth.


What You Will Need to be Successful:

* Bachelor's degree or equivalent professional experience

* 5+ years technical project management or service delivery management experience

* Experience presenting technical information to customers and executives

* Experience with Microsoft 365 suite, specifically PowerPoint, Excel, Loop, Planner and Project

* United States Citizenship

* Ability to obtain a TS security clearance.

* Ability to travel up to 10% of the time

* US Citizenship for this position is required by law due to federal customer contracts


Nice to Have:

* 10+ years technical project management or service delivery management experience

* Prior construction project experience

* PMP certification or equivalent

* Active TS security clearance with eligibility for additional accesses as needed
